    Here is my VK V8 that I bought to use as a daily driver.
    Anyway here are the specs:

    Model: VK
    Colour: Red
    Engine Type: 4.9L V8 (LV2)
    Engine Mods: None
    Power: Unknown
    Exhaust: 2.5 inch, standard manifold
    Gearbox: Trimatic
    Diff: LSD
    Brakes: Disk brakes all round.
    Suspension: FE2
    Wheels/Tyres: 14s
    Interior: Stock

    I need to replace the carby cos it is stuffed, should I just buy a recond quadrajet or something else?

    Future plans are just to get upgraded brakes, then maybe later on I'll throw in a mild cam when I get the engine rebuilt.

    look on the model code on the build plate, should say 8VK69-BT1. The diffs are a 10 bolt sals, if its factory V8.

    Default

    Quote Originally Posted by Pav View Post
    Yeah I have already ordered a rebuilt quaddy from ebay, but in future will I have to modify it or get a new carby when I increase the power? For eg I am planning to get extractors, better intake manifold, 286 cam etc.

    Also forgot to mention I paid $1400 for this beauty
    As said above id be sticky with the quady. Its a great carby and can still make plenty of power, and can be jetted up. The holleys etc are a race carby, I would never use one on a street car, chews way to much petrol for a small benefit.
